(STRONG TWP, ON) – On Tuesday October 27, 2015 shortly before 3:00 p.m. the Almaguin Highlands Ontario Provincial Police (OPP) received a call for service regarding a male who had been shot on his property by an unknown person.
Officers from the Almaguin Highlands Detachment including their Crime Unit along with members from the North Bay Crime Unit, North East Region Canine, Emergency Response Team (ERT) and Forensic Identification Services (FIS) attended the High Street property where the incident took place.
The male was taken to hospital with non-life threatening injuries by Parry Sound Emergency Medical Services (EMS) and was later released.
Further police investigation revealed that the facts initially reported to police did not occur and the male’s injuries were a result of an accidental discharge.
Police arrested and charged Mark GATES, 20 of Strong Township with the following:
• Public mischief, contrary to section 140(1) of the Criminal Code
• Careless use of a firearm, contrary to section 88(6) of the Criminal Code
• Unauthorized possession of a firearm, contrary to section 91(1) of the Criminal Code.
The accused was released from police custody and is to appear at the Ontario Court of Justice on Thursday, December 10, 2015 in Sundridge Ontario.
